What Is Rupert Murdoch’s Net Worth? – Keith Rupert Murdoch is an highly accomplished Australian-born American business tycoon, media mogul, and investor with a career spanning for decades
Born on born on March 11, 1931, in Melbourne, Australia, Murdoch is known for owning several media channels around the world through his company News Corp. The Sun and The Times in the United Kingdom, The Daily Telegraph, Herald Sun, and The Australian in Australia, and The Wall Street Journal and The New York Post in the United States are among them.
Rupert Murdoch also controls HarperCollins and television networks such as Sky News Australia and Fox News. Following his father’s death in 1952, he took over The News, a small Adelaide newspaper owned by his father.
He gradually expanded his media holdings, both in Australia as well as internationally. In 1974, he relocated to the United States, where he held holdings in various countries.
Murdoch’s media business grew dramatically over time. In 1981, he purchased important assets such as The Times, and in 1985, he became a naturalised US citizen to meet ownership requirements for US television networks.
With purchases such as Twentieth Century Fox in 1985, HarperCollins in 1989, and The Wall Street Journal in 2007, his media holdings rose even more.
Murdoch’s media and political power has not been without controversy. His newspapers and television networks have been accused of prejudice and deceptive coverage, which has frequently favoured his corporate interests and political allies.
His influence on political developments has been highlighted in the United Kingdom, the United States, and Australia.
Throughout his career, Murdoch has been involved in various political activities, often aligning with political leaders and parties that serve his interests.
His media outlets have supported and influenced politicians in different countries, including Margaret Thatcher in the UK and Tony Blair later on.
Despite controversies and changes in his political affiliations, Murdoch has remained a significant figure in the media industry, known for his ability to shape public opinion and influence political landscapes.
What Is Rupert Murdoch’s Net Worth?
His net worth is estimated to be over $21.4 billion as of 2023 according to Forbes magazine. Murdoch’s Net Worth primarily comes from his earnings as a business magnate, media mogul, and investor, with his successful businesses contributing to his financial success.
